Specific Environmental Indicators
The development of the specific environmental data relative to output show a pleasing trend: Over the past five years, there has been a clear reduction in the link between growth, consumption of resources and environmental impact. The specific data were also lower than in 2004. The only exception here comprises specific emissions into the air (excluding CO2 and CO), which rose, mainly because of higher sulfur dioxide emissions (see Statistics, page 28). In addition to the aggregate data for the Group reported here, plant-specific data are available in the SuRe system, reflecting the reporting structure. This allows efficient internal benchmarking, an evaluation of ESHQ performance and intensive sustainability checks. Moreover, all analyses can be performed on the basis of either company structures or management structures.
